About Vanguard Founded in 1975, Vanguard is one of the world's leading investment management companies. The firm offers investments, advice, and retirement services to tens of millions of individual investors around the globe-directly, through workplace plans, and through financial intermediaries. Role Summary The Talent Acquisition Consultant/Specialist plays a key role in managing the end-to-end recruitment process, ensuring the organization attracts and hires top talent. This role involves supporting sourcing, interviewing, and hiring efforts while collaborating with hiring managers to understand workforce needs. The consultant is responsible for refining recruitment strategies, conducting market research, and enhancing candidate experience. Additionally, this role involves data analysis, process improvement, and ensuring compliance with best hiring practices. Core Responsibilities 1. Support the entire recruitment cycle, including sourcing, interviewing, reference checks, and offer extensions. 2. Partner with hiring managers to identify staffing needs and develop tailored recruitment strategies. 3. Source potential candidates using various online channels, job boards, and networking strategies. 4. Coordinate and schedule interviews, developing relevant interview questions with hiring managers. 5. Plan and execute interview and selection procedures, including screening calls, assessments, and in-person interviews. 6. Prepare job offer materials, ensuring alignment with job specifications and organizational guidelines. 7. Generate and analyze recruitment reports, tracking key hiring metrics and market trends to improve hiring strategies. 8. Represent the organization at job fairs and other hiring events to attract top talent. 9. Contribute to the development of recruitment processes and best practices to optimize efficiency. 10. Participate in special projects and other talent acquisition initiatives as assigned.
